The Easiest Way: Official Exam Body Portals and Apps

The fastest and safest way to check your score is always through the official website or app of the exam body. These portals are built to handle result checks and give you the correct information directly.

Checking WAEC Results on Your Phone

To check your WAEC (WASSCE) result on your phone, you need to buy a result checker PIN. You can buy this PIN online from the WAEC official website or from approved banks and agents. Once you have the PIN, follow these steps:

1. Open your phone’s browser (like Chrome or Safari).
2. Go to the official WAEC result checking website: www.waecdirect.org.
3. Enter your 10-digit WAEC Examination Number.
4. Select your exam year.
5. Select the exam type (e.g., May/June WASSCE).
6. Enter the Scratch Card PIN you bought.
7. Click “Submit” to see your result.

You can also use the MyWAEC Result Checker app, which you can download from the Google Play Store. The process inside the app is the same.

Checking NECO Results on Your Phone

For NECO (SSCE) results, you also need a Token. You can buy this token online via the NECO website using debit cards or other payment methods. Here’s how to check:

1. On your phone browser, go to: result.neco.gov.ng.
2. Select your exam type (e.g., June/July SSCE).
3. Enter your year of examination.
4. Type in your NECO Token number (the one you purchased).
5. Enter your Registration Number.
6. Click “Check Result”. Your score will load on the screen.

Checking JAMB UTME/DE Results on Your Phone

JAMB makes it easy to check your score for free. You do not need a PIN for the main UTME score.

1. Open your browser and go to the official JAMB result portal: www.portal.jamb.gov.ng/efacility.
2. Log in to your JAMB profile using your email and password. (You created this during registration).
3. After logging in, look for a menu option like “Check UTME Results” or “My Results”.
4. Click on it. Your score will be displayed on the screen.

You can also check by sending an SMS. From the phone number you used to register for JAMB, simply text RESULT to 55019. You will get a reply with your score. Note that you may be charged a small fee for this SMS.

Using SMS Shortcodes for Quick Checks

For some exams, the fastest method is a simple text message (SMS). This is very useful if you have a basic phone or if internet data is a problem.

JAMB Score via SMS (The 55019 Method)

As mentioned, the JAMB SMS method is very reliable. Make sure you are using the exact phone number you registered with JAMB. Just type the word RESULT and send it to 55019. Within a few minutes, you should get a reply like: “Dear [Your Name], your score is 280.” If your result is not ready, you will get a message telling you to check back later.

Checking WAEC GCE (Private Candidate) Results

For WAEC GCE (Second Series), you can also use SMS. Send an SMS in this format: WASSCE*ExamNo*PIN*ExamYear to 32327. For example: WASSCE*4250101001*123456789012*2024. You will receive your result details as an SMS.

Using Mobile Apps for Result Checking

Many official exam bodies and trusted third-party services have mobile apps. These apps can be faster than using a browser because they are designed for mobile use.

Official and Trusted Apps to Download

Here are some apps you can get from the Google Play Store (for Android) or Apple App Store (for iPhone):

– MyWAEC Result Checker: The official app for checking WAEC results.
– JAMB CAPS eFacility: An unofficial but widely used app that provides easy access to the JAMB portal for checking results and admission status.
– NECO Result Checker: There are several helper apps that guide you to the official NECO website quickly.
– School Portal Apps: Many schools also have their own apps where they post students’ results. Check if your school has one.

When using any app, make sure it has good reviews and is from a trusted developer to avoid scams.

What You Need Before You Check

To make the process smooth and fast, have these details ready on your phone before you start:

– Your Examination Number: This is the number on your exam slip. Keep it handy.
– Scratch Card PIN or Token: For WAEC and NECO, you must have purchased this.
– Registered Phone Number: For JAMB SMS, you must use the number linked to your profile.
– Stable Internet Connection: For browser and app checks, a good connection prevents errors.
– JAMB Login Details: Remember your email and password for the JAMB portal.

Common Problems and Fast Fixes

Sometimes things don’t go smoothly. Here are quick fixes for common problems.

“Result Not Found” or “Invalid Details” Error

This usually means you typed something wrong. Double-check your exam number, year, and PIN. Make sure there are no spaces. For JAMB, ensure you are logged into the correct profile. If it still doesn’t work, wait a few hours or a day. Results are sometimes released in batches.

Website Not Loading on Your Phone

If the official website is slow or won’t load, it could be because too many people are checking at the same time. Try checking very early in the morning or late at night when traffic is low. You can also switch from mobile data to Wi-Fi, or vice versa.

SMS Not Delivering or No Reply

First, confirm you have airtime on your phone. The SMS service might charge a small fee. Ensure you are sending the correct keyword to the correct shortcode. If you get no reply after 10 minutes, try again later. The server might be busy.

Important Security Tips

Always protect your personal information when checking results online.

– Only Use Official Links: Type the website addresses yourself or use bookmarks. Do not click on links from random emails or messages.
– Never Share Your PIN/Token: Your result checker PIN is like money. Anyone who has it can check your result. Keep it secret.
– Log Out of Portals: After checking your result on a shared or public phone, always log out of the JAMB or WAEC portal.
– Beware of Fake Apps and Agents: Only download apps from official stores. Do not pay anyone who claims they can “upgrade” your score—it is a scam.

People Also Ask

Can I check my WAEC result for free?
No, checking WAEC results officially requires a PIN or Token which you must purchase. Any website claiming free WAEC checks is likely not official and could be unsafe.

Is the JAMB result SMS free?
No, it is not free. You will be charged a small fee (about N50) for the SMS service when you send “RESULT” to 55019.

What if I lost my WAEC scratch card PIN?
If you lost the physical card, you cannot recover the PIN. You will need to buy a new one. If you bought it online, check your email for the digital PIN.

Can I use my parents’ phone number to check JAMB results?
Yes, you can, but only if that was the exact phone number you used to register for your JAMB exam. The system sends the result to the registered number.

Why is my result not showing on the portal?
It could be for a few reasons: your result is not yet released, you are checking too early, there is an error in your details, or your result is being withheld by the exam body. Check for official announcements from WAEC, NECO, or JAMB.

The Fastest Method Summary

To sum it up, here is the quickest way for each exam:

– JAMB: Send SMS with “RESULT” to 55019. It’s almost instant.
– WAEC: Use the WAECDirect website on your browser with your PIN ready.
– NECO: Go to result.neco.gov.ng on your browser with your Token ready.
– School Exams: Check if your school has a dedicated student portal or app.
